Spurgeon reflected on God’s grace throughout his career as a preacher and teacher. The best-selling All of Grace contains chapters on justification, forgiveness, faith, the regeneration of the Holy Spirit, and much more. Since its first publication more than a century ago, All of Grace has sold more than one million copies! Spurgeon is one of the church’s most famous preachers and Christianity’s most prolific writers. He preached more than 500 sermons by the age of 20. Spurgeon’s preaching deeply influenced Dwight L. Moody; he founded the Moody Bible Institute after seeing Spurgeon’s work at the Pastor’s College in London. By the time of Spurgeon’s death in 1892, he had preached almost 3,600 sermons and published, also under the name Charles H.
